Brief summary

The purpose of this study is to assess the efficacy of QBX258, a compound developed by Novartis Corporation composed of two antibodies, in reducing arm volume excess in women with stage I-II breast cancer related lymphedema.

Inclusion criteria

* Women 18-70 with unilateral stage I or II BCRL * Volume difference of at least 300 mL between the normal and lymphedematous limb based on perometry evaluation * BMI of 18-30 * No current evidence of breast cancer * At least 6 months postop from axillary lymph node dissection

Exclusion criteria

* Bilateral lymphedema or history of bilateral axillary lymph node dissection * Recent history of cellulitis in the affected extremity (within last 3 months) * Recurrent breast cancer or other malignancy * Current (within last month) use of chemotherapy for breast or other malignancy * Current (within last 3 months) use of radiation for breast or other malignancy * Recent (within last month) or current intensive MLD and/or short stretch bandage use * Unstable lymphedema (i.e. worsening symptoms/measurements in the past 3 months) * Pregnant or nursing (lactating) women * Stage III lymphedema * Patients that take acetaminophen (paracetamol) chronically, i.e. more than 1 g/day for more than 3 out of 7 days, or more than 2 g/ day for more than 1 day out of 7 days * Use of other investigational drugs at the time of enrollment, or within 30 days or 5 half-lives of enrollment, whichever is longer * History of hypersensitivity to any of the study drugs or to drugs of similar chemical classes (e.g. monoclonal antibodies, polyclonal gamma globulin, polysorbates).

This will be a single arm, open label design pilot study, aiming to test the efficacy of QBX258, a combination of two fully human monoclonal antibodies that neutralize the biologic activity of interleukin 4 and interleukin 13 (IL4/IL13), for the treatment of stage I or II breast cancer related upper extremity lymphedema (BCRL). QBX258: Once patients are registered for the trial, they will be treated with QBX258 (VAK694 3mg/kg and QAX576 6mg/kg) delivered via peripheral intravenous injection once every 4 weeks (+ 1 week) for 4 treatments.
